How to import full reports/stories

When I create a Nprinting report I see all of my assets(Images,Tables, ect..) I am wondering if it is possible to just import the full report or story rather than rebuilding it. For example I have a report I am building for another employee who has raw data set sheet and such but also has a user story power point they want sent out through Nprinting. This is my goal. When I set up Nprinting though I am shown all of my assets, tables, images ect. I would just like to simply pull in the power point that is already there rather than recreating it if possible.

Hi,

Reusability of stories is not possible in NPrinting.

The only configuration which allows you to do this is Entity reports build in QlikView!

Qlik Sense stories however work differently and cannot be used for scheduled reporting purpose.
